RESOLUTION 08-106(A)

 

A RESOLUTION OF THE HOMER CITY COUNCIL CONFIRMING THE ASSESSMENT ROLL, ESTABLISHING DATES FOR PAYMENT OF SPECIAL ASSESSMENTS AND ESTABLISHING DELINQUENCY, PENALTY AND INTEREST PROVISIONS FOR THE SPRUCEVIEW AND WEST NOVIEW ROAD RECONSTRUCTION AND PAVING ASSESSMENT DISTRICT.

 

            WHEREAS, In compliance with Chapter 17, Improvement District, of the Homer City Code, the Homer City Council created a Road Reconstruction and Paving Improvement District for Spruceview Avenue and West Noview/South Mullikin/South Wright Streets; and

 

            WHEREAS, Spruceview Avenue Road Reconstruction and Paving Improvement District was created via Resolution 04-50 on May 25, 2004, and West Noview was created via Resolution 05-78 on July 25, 2005, both at the property owner share of assessments $30 per front foot for reconstruction and $17 per front foot for paving; and

 

            WHEREAS, A public hearing was held on June 24, 2004 for Spruceview and a public hearing was held on August 22, 2005 for West Noview to hear objections to the formation of such districts; and

 

            WHEREAS, Resolution 04-76 was adopted by Council on September 13, 2004 for Spruceview and Resolution 05-107 was adopted by Council on October 24, 2005 for West Noview authorizing the formation of the Spruceview and West Noview Road Reconstruction and Paving Improvement Districts; and

 

            WHEREAS, In the 2008 construction season improvements for Spruceview and West Noview Road Reconstruction and Paving Improvement Districts were completed; and

 

            WHEREAS, The Spruceview and West Noview Road Reconstruction and Paving Improvement District, after completion, was accepted for City Maintenance and forwarded for final process and a public hearing date was set for April 28, 2008 via Resolution 08-32; and

 

            WHEREAS, An assessment roll was prepared and a public hearing was held on April 28, 2008 and again on August 25, 2008 to hear objections for the purpose of making corrections to the final assessment roll; and

 

            WHEREAS, All assessment per parcel corrections deemed necessary have been made; and

 

            WHEREAS, The assessment roll as presented by the City Clerk and reviewed and corrected where necessary and attached hereto as Attachment A, is hereby confirmed as the official assessment roll for the Spruceview and West Noview Road Reconstruction and Paving Improvement District and the Mayor and Clerk shall be directed to sign same.

            N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T RESOLVED THAT ON OR BEFORE 5:00 p.m. on April 1, 2009, all assessments in the Spruceview and West Noview Road Reconstruction and Paving Assessment District shall become due and payable in full. All assessments not paid in full by this date shall be considered delinquent and in default and shall have added a penalty of ten percent (10%) which penalty and principal amount of the assessment shall both draw interest at a rate of one and one half percent (1.5%) per annum until paid. Should default occur, the City of Homer will institute a civil action for a foreclosure of the assessment lien. Foreclosure shall be against all property on which assessments are in default. All costs including collection and legal fees resulting from such action, shall be added and incorporated into the assessed amount due plus interest and penalties and shall be reimbursed from the proceeds of foreclosure sale of the assessed real property; and

 

            BE IT FURTHER RESOLVED that an optional ten (10) year payment plan is offered whereby the assessment may be paid in ten (10) equal yearly installments plus interest of one and one half percent (1.5%) on the unpaid balance of the assessment. The first such installment shall be due and payable without interest on or before 5:00 p.m. April 1, 2009 and each installment thereafter shall be due on or before April, of each year, plus interest on the unpaid balance of the assessment. If any annual installment payment is not received when due, the entire outstanding principal amount of the assessment shall be in default and shall be immediately due and payable. The entire outstanding assessment principal (including the annual installment) shall have added a penalty of ten percent (10%) on the outstanding principal. The principal and penalty shall draw interest at the rate of fifteen percent (15%) per annum until paid. Should default occur, the City will institute civil action for foreclosure of the assessment lien. Foreclosure shall be against all property on which assessments are in default. All costs including collection and legal fees resulting from such action shall be added and incorporated into the assessed amount due plus interest and penalties, and shall be reimbursed from the proceeds of foreclosure sale of the assessed real property.

                       

            PASSED AND ADOPTED by the Homer City Council on this 13th day of October, 2008.

Fiscal Note: Property owners’ share $30 per front foot for road reconstruction and $17 per front foot for paving for a total of $316,705.45; $1,148,442.55 paid by City.
